49 Fit is a fitness and wellness challenge in which you compete with yourself in the name of consistency through April! 49 Fit encourages you to branch out from what you usually do for your health and dial in what you already do well!

Log each activity session either on the posters hanging around the SRC, Patty complex, and ski hut, or log them digitally with the link on our website. You earn points for each completed activity and can exchange your total points for the month for prizes at Outdoor Adventures. Updates will be sent to participants on April 15th and May 1st.

Outdoor Adventures is hiring for the summer! 🐻‍❄️ Come work with us!

Full-time during the summer Starting Salary $17.19/hr
This position will manage the Outdoor Adventures Rental Center
for our open hours, Mon-Fri. This position will also help to lead
Outdoor Adventures (OA) trips. OA will provide a wide variety of
training and certification courses. Interviews begin March 30th.

Training opportunities:
Wilderness First Responder Certification, Swiftwater Rescue Training, Sport Climbing Instructor Training, Trailer Driving Training, etc

2026 Summer Trips that require student assistant aid:
Gates of the Arctic Backpacking Trip, Yukon River Canoe from Eagle to
Circle, Various day trips in the interior and more.

Other benefits:
Free rental equipment, summer membership to the Student
Recreation Center, continued employment at reduced hours during the academic year
